romy: Verschachtelte Pseudoformate

Beitrag lesen

Hallo!
Ich baue hier gerade an meiner Homepage und versuche die Formatierung auf vernünftige StyleSheets zu basieren um nicht überall die schrecklichen <font>-Tags zu haben.
Dazu verwende ich auch die Pseudoformate
a:link,
a:visited,
a:hover,
a:active.

Nun wollte ich aber meine Links in einem Teil meiner Page auf die eine Art formatieren und in einem anderen Teil auf eine andere.

Dies scheint aber so NICHT zu funktionieren (auch wenn ich keinen zwingenden Logikfehler darin sehen kann).

Meine Frage ist also nun, ob ich hier einen Fehler gemacht habe, oder ob die Kombination von Verschachtelung und Pseudoformaten einfach nicht unterstützt wird - wenn dem so ist wäre ich für Tips dankbar, wie man dies elegant lösen kann.
(Und nicht in jeden <a>-Tag noch einen <font>-Tag setzen muss...)

-->zu Deiner direkten Frage kann ich nichts sagen, aber ich denke es gibt eine elegane Lösung für das Problem, erstelle einfach Klassen für die verschiedenen links,
zB.

du kreierst den standartlink, so wie du es schon gemacht hast, also
a {blabla }

a:link,
a:visited,
a:hover,
a:active.

und dann setzt du einfach ein

.meinKlassenName {  } und schreibst die Veränderungen da rein

und bindest das im HTML wie folgt ein

<a href="blabla.de" class="meinKlassenName">hsad</a>